Merge changes I1572338c,I39965007

* changes:
  logd: liblog: logcat: Add LogWhiteBlackList
  logd: prune by worst offending UID
diff --git a/fs_mgr/fs_mgr.c b/fs_mgr/fs_mgr.c
index 0a0a08a..c4f27a0 100644
--- a/fs_mgr/fs_mgr.c
+++ b/fs_mgr/fs_mgr.c
@@ -260,9 +260,9 @@
 
         /* back up errno as partition_wipe clobbers the value */
         mount_errno = errno;
-
         /* mount(2) returned an error, check if it's encryptable and deal with it */
-        if ((fstab->recs[i].fs_mgr_flags & MF_CRYPT) &&
+        if (mount_errno != EBUSY && mount_errno != EACCES &&
+            (fstab->recs[i].fs_mgr_flags & MF_CRYPT) &&
             !partition_wiped(fstab->recs[i].blk_device)) {
             /* Need to mount a tmpfs at this mountpoint for now, and set
              * properties that vold will query later for decrypting